Latest Patents
Cohen holds a patent for a buccal swab delivery system. This device is designed to deliver a drug product via a swab, featuring an applicator platform housed within a rigid housing. The applicator platform is structured as a plunger, and it includes a foil drug reservoir cap that creates a fluid storage chamber. This chamber is positioned between the foil drug reservoir cap and the plunger. A series of fluidic channels facilitate the movement of fluid from the storage chamber to the applicator. The device also incorporates a frangible seal that prevents fluid from moving until the plunger is actuated, allowing for controlled drug delivery.
